Description
Delicious, warm homemade soft pretzels that are easy to make and perfect for sharing.
Ingredients
Scale
- 1 1⁄2 cups warm water (110°F/45°C)
- 1 packet (2 1⁄4 tsp) active dry yeast
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 tbsp granulated sugar
- 4 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 tbsp unsalted butter, melted
- 10 cups water
- 2⁄3 cup baking soda
- 1 large egg, beaten
- Coarse sea salt for sprinkling
Instructions
- In a large bowl, dissolve the yeast in warm water and let it sit for 5 minutes until foamy.
- Stir in salt, sugar, melted butter, and flour, mixing until a dough forms. Knead on a floured surface for 8-10 minutes until smooth.
-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let it rise for about 1 hour or until doubled in size.
-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In a large pot, bring 10 cups of water and baking soda to a boil.
- Divide the dough into 8 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a 20-24 inch rope and shape it into a pretzel.
- Using a slotted spatula, dip each pretzel into the boiling water for 30 seconds, then transfer to the prepared baking sheets.
- Brush the pretzels with beaten egg and sprinkle with coarse sea salt.
-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until golden brown. Let cool slightly before serving.
Notes
Store any leftover pretzels in a paper bag at room temperature for up to two days. For longer storage, w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and place them in an airtight container.
